ICA Technician
Great new opportunity for an Operational Technology ICA Technician to join our team at Tolgus Depot. Starting salary from £36,008 plus excellent benefits (depending on experience) . This role offers the chance to build your technical qualifications and progress within a supportive operational team.
The Role
As an Operational Technology ICA Technician , you’ll maintain and calibrate regulatory monitoring equipment, analytical instrumentation and process sensors across our operations. You’ll complete planned maintenance and respond quickly to operational issues, carrying out onsite analysis, diagnosis and problem resolution while ensuring compliance with established standards and change processes.
You’ll need to be resilient and adaptable, able to manage changing priorities with a positive, flexible approach. The technology you’ll work with is varied and interesting, including sensors, instrumentation, process control and telemetry.
What you’ll be doing
Carry out planned and reactive maintenance on instrumentation, telemetry and regulatory equipment.
Diagnose and resolve operational issues quickly to maintain performance and compliance.
Support cost‑effective improvements and ensure adherence to standards and change processes.
Work collaboratively with OT, ICA, mechanical and electrical teams to prioritise and deliver work.
Use electrical/control/process knowledge to optimise systems and reduce operational risk.
Assist with root‑cause investigations and drive effective resolutions.
Contribute to compliance with legislation (e.g., UK NIS) and support technical standards.
Promote strong health & safety practices and support risk assessments and safe working procedures.
Maintain skills through required training and support IT/OT governance and documentation updates.
What we’re looking for
GCSEs (Maths, English, Science) or equivalent, plus relevant industrial control apprenticeship/qualifications and ONC/HNC in a related discipline.
Experience with process control, ELV/LV electrical systems and PLCs (ideally Schneider), including programming and communication protocols.
Strong fault‑finding and repair skills, with knowledge of instrumentation calibration, process sensors, telemetry and low‑power radio systems.
ATEX/CompEx certified and compliant with current IEE regulations.
Experience in drinking and waste water treatment automation processes.
Excellent IT, communication and organisational skills, with the ability to work independently and manage changing priorities.
Proactive, innovative and safety‑focused, promoting wellbeing and safe working practices.
Understands information security policies, builds strong stakeholder relationships, and maintains up‑to‑date technical and business knowledge.
Full UK drivers licence and able to travel around the work area using company vehicle
Ability to complete UK Government Security Clearance (SC) process successfully
